article thumbnail

PNNL Develops Plug-in Vehicle Smart Charger Controller for Managing Peak Demands in Grid

Green Car Congress

Researchers at the Department of Energy’s Pacific Northwest National Laboratory (PNNL) have developed a Smart Charger Controller for plug-in vehicles that will automatically recharge vehicles during times of least cost to the consumer and lower demand for power. Widespread use of these devices could help advance a smart power grid.
